Senior Civil Designer | Anaheim, CA
IMEGAbout the role
IMEG is hiring a Senior Civil Designer in Anaheim, CA, to lead the delivery of large and highly complex civil engineering projects as a project manager or lead designer. In this role, you’ll provide project direction, advanced engineering analysis, design and implementation oversight, and technical guidance to help achieve positive client outcomes. You’ll also support projects within budget, mentor and train team members, and collaborate with cross-functional teams to meet project goals and client expectations.
Principal Responsibilities
Lead civil engineering design efforts based on written scope for large, highly complex projects
Create detailed designs, specifications, and calculations using engineering software/tools in accordance with code requirements and IMEG standards
Perform site assessments and develop detailed analysis and technical reports
Partner with clients to gather requirements and communicate technical information effectively
Build and maintain client relationships through professional communication
Conduct in-process reviews of calculations, specifications, and project correspondence
Implement IMEG quality control processes to meet IMEG, industry, and client quality standards
Provide technical training and mentoring; review work by others as needed
Support resolution of field issues with minimal support from senior staff
Prioritize safety and regulatory compliance, including interpretation and application of state and local design criteria
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ams to deliver integrated solutions that meet project goals
Participate in project interviews and project presentations
Required Qualifications and Skills
Bachelor of Science (BS) Degree in Civil Engineering, or equivalent required
10 years of experience minimum required, 12 preferred, in the civil engineering consulting industry
OR
Associates degree, or certificate, in utilizing Autodesk Civil 3D or equivalent software tools or engineering preferred
14 years of experience minimum required, 16 preferred, in the civil engineering consulting or construction industry
Lead the design and analysis of Civil Engineering project features utilizing Autodesk Civil 3D or equivalent software tools to create detailed designs, specifications, and calculations according to code requirements and IMEG standards
Strong training, mentoring and leadership skills
Ability to perform final quality control check in their area of expertise
Ability to sell work and develop client relationships
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ills; Ability to clearly communicate in both oral and written communication to individuals or groups
Ability to work collaboratively in a team environment
Attention to detail and problem-solving skills
Eagerness to adapt to new challenges
Proficient with MS Office Suite including but not limited to Word, Excel, and Outlook
Ability to travel up to 20% with occasional overnight stays

Civil Team Highlights
IMEG has been a leader in civil engineering for over 75 years, supporting projects across private and public sectors.
Civil specialties include municipal engineering, land development, surveying, environmental services, and construction inspection.
The land development team supports site planning, grading, utilities, and permitting to help turn raw land into buildable sites.
Civil and structural teams support bridge design, rehabilitation, and inspection.
